The easiest way to reduce debt is to stop buying junk, period. People are creatures of habit so take a look at your previous 3 months of expenses and look for the patterns of spending. My wife and I did this and noticed that we were eating out regularly and decided we were going to start writing down where we eat and now we eat meals at home and save a lot of money. But for a while we were starting to get in the habit of eating out just because we were tired from work so we decided to take action. We now come home for dinner and then go walking for thirty minutes after our meals. We are saving money and fitting in exercise.

If you are looking to reduce debts that you have, the secret is in your habits. People who have a habit of bringing lunch to work, save a few dollars a day by doing so. If you have a habit of eating lunch at restaurants, you will spend a few dollars more than the person bringing lunch. Money Saving Tip: Calculate the amount of money you would spend on lunch, $5, $7, $10. Then bring your lunch the next day. After lunch log on to your bank account and transfer the money you would have spent on lunch from your checking into your Orange Savings Account.

In one month you would have paid yourself the following depending on how much you spend on lunch:

$5 x 5 days x month = $100 (5 day work week)
$7 x 5 days x month = $140 (5 day work week)
$10 x 5 days x month = $200 (5 day work week)

What can you do with an extra $100-$200 a month? What if your spouse did the same thing?
